Training simulator provides students with an opportunity to develop initial skills in diagnosing, maintaining, and repairing automotive gearboxes.
The simulator consists of a 5-speed manual transmission assembly, where key components are dissected and presented in an open manner. The dissected sections are finely colored, and spotlights are configured to make internal structures (input/output shafts, gears, etc.) clearly visible. This experimental platform enables students to realistically understand the composition of the transmission mechanical system, the appearance of each component, and the connection relationships between mechanisms, deepening their knowledge of the gearbox's structure and working principles.
● The manual transmission operates normally, allowing students to study its functionality under real-world conditions.
● The gearbox can be fully disassembled to demonstrate both internal and external structures of the mechanical parts, providing hands-on experience in understanding its design.
● Mechanical parts of the gearbox are painted in different colors for better visualization and identification of individual components.
● An AC motor drives the input shaft of the gearbox, demonstrating the power transmission process under different gears. This feature allows students to observe how torque is transferred through the transmission system.
● The simulator includes a gear shift lever for practicing gear changes, enhancing practical skills in operating the transmission.
